Factory for Metal Surface Treatment
The metal surface treatment factory is a specialized facility that focuses on improving the surface quality of various metal products. This process involves a series of chemical, mechanical, and electrochemical operations to enhance the appearance, durability, and performance of metals.
Production Method
The production method in a metal surface treatment factory typically involves the following steps:
1. Cleaning: The metal products are thoroughly cleaned to remove dirt, oil, and other contaminants.
2. Degreasing: The cleaned metal products are then degreased to remove any remaining oils and greases.
3. Pickling: The degreased metal products are then pickled in a solution of acid and water to remove any impurities and scale.
4. Passivation: The pickled metal products are then passivated to form a thin layer of oxide on the surface, which provides corrosion resistance.
5. Coating: The passivated metal products are then coated with a layer of paint, powder, or other materials to enhance their appearance and durability.
Business Sectors
The metal surface treatment factory serves a variety of business sectors, including:
1. Automotive industry: Metal surface treatment is used to improve the appearance and durability of car parts, such as wheels, engines, and chassis.
2. Aerospace industry: Metal surface treatment is used to improve the corrosion resistance and durability of aircraft and spacecraft components.
3. Construction industry: Metal surface treatment is used to improve the appearance and durability of building materials, such as roofing and cladding.
